253464167661 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 345829845504. Its totient is φ = 165037716144.
The previous prime is 253464167639. The next prime is 253464167681. The reversal of 253464167661 is 166761464352.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 253464167661 - 26 = 253464167597 is a prime.
It is a Curzon number.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(253464167611)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 3173560 + ... + 3252446.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(21614365344).
Almost surely, 2253464167661 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
253464167661 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(92365677843).
253464167661 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
253464167661 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 103840.
The product of its digits is 4354560, while the sum is 51.
The spelling of 253464167661 in words is "two hundred fifty-three billion, four hundred sixty-four million, one hundred sixty-seven thousand, six hundred sixty-one".
